      <study_design>Randomization: Randomized, Blinding: Double blinded, Placebo: Not used, Assignment: Parallel, Purpose: Treatment, Randomization description: Arrangement of the randomization process:

1) Determining the volume of each block (quadruple blocks)
2) Preparing the list of the blocks and assigning a number to each of them
  AABB(1)      ABAB(2)      ABBA(3)     BBAA(4)      BABA(5)     BAAB(6)
3) Choosing random numbers between 1 and 6
4) Defining the treatment assignment list
For example: AABB(1)_BBAA(4)_ABAB(2)_BABA(5), Blinding description: The participants (patients) and the researcher who have the task of sampling in the study are all blind during the study. At the patient's level, blindness will be done as the patients do not know in which group (control or intervention group) they are in. The researcher on the basis of lable A or B without knowing the nature of A, B and according to the randomized list will give the medicine to pateints or not.</study_design>
      <phase>2-3</phase>
      <hc_freetext>diabetic nouropathy.</hc_freetext>
      <i_freetext>Intervention 1: Intervention group:  received memantine 5 mg twice daily in the first week and received memantine 10 mg from week 2 to week 8 twice daily. Intervention 2: Control group: routin care which includes Cap Gabapentin 300 mg once daily at night.</i_freetext>
